Details:
On March 19th then 20th, the Moon was 1.0 then 2.1 days old, appearing below and above Venus, respectively. The purple sky backgrounding the equinox Moon and Venus was a special delight.

#1: Venus above Moon
#2: Venus below Moon in a purple sky
#3: Venus below Moon 10 minutes later
